1. People Who Own Above-Ground Swimming Pools
For people who own above-ground swimming pools, dreaming about their backyard oasis can take on various meanings. The pool often represents a place of relaxation, leisure, and enjoyment. For some, it symbolizes a sanctuary where they can escape the stresses of life and find solace. The act of swimming in the pool can be a metaphor for moving through life's challenges with grace and ease.
Dreams about above-ground swimming pools can also reflect a person's emotional state. If the pool is full and sparkling clean, it may suggest feelings of contentment and fulfillment. Conversely, a pool that is empty or dirty can symbolize emotional emptiness or turmoil. The condition of the pool water can also provide insights into a person's subconscious thoughts and feelings. Clear and refreshing water may indicate clarity of mind and emotional purity, while murky or polluted water can represent confusion, anxiety, or unresolved issues.
Furthermore, the presence of others in the pool can reveal aspects of a person's relationships and social interactions. Swimming with friends or family members can symbolize harmony and closeness, while being alone in the pool may reflect feelings of isolation or loneliness. Additionally, the actions taking place in the pool, such as swimming, diving, or playing games, can offer clues about a person's current life circumstances and challenges.
Overall, dreams about above-ground swimming pools can provide valuable insights into the inner workings of the mind and emotions of people who own these backyard luxuries. By analyzing the various elements and symbols present in these dreams, individuals can gain a deeper understanding of themselves and their life experiences.
2. People Who Are Afraid of Water
For individuals with aquaphobia, or the fear of water, dreams about above-ground swimming pools can be particularly evocative and emotionally charged. These dreams often tap into deep-seated anxieties and fears, offering a glimpse into the subconscious mind's attempt to process and resolve these emotions.
Confronting Inner Fears: Dreaming of an above-ground swimming pool can represent a symbolic confrontation with one's fear of water. The pool, with its contained and controlled environment, may symbolize a safe space in which the dreamer can gradually confront and challenge their fears.
Emotional Vulnerability: The act of entering an above-ground swimming pool in a dream can symbolize a sense of emotional vulnerability. The dreamer may feel exposed and susceptible to harm, just as they might feel vulnerable to the water in real life.
Isolation and Loneliness: An empty above-ground swimming pool, devoid of water and activity, can evoke feelings of isolation and loneliness. The dreamer may feel disconnected from others and unable to fully participate in life's joys and experiences.
Overcoming Obstacles: Dreams about successfully swimming or playing in an above-ground pool can signify personal growth and overcoming obstacles. The dreamer may be recognizing their ability to confront their fears and emerge victorious.
Seeking Support and Understanding: The presence of others in a dream about an above-ground swimming pool can symbolize the dreamer's desire for support and understanding from loved ones. These dreams may highlight the importance of seeking guidance and reassurance during challenging times.
By exploring the symbolism and emotions associated with dreams about above-ground swimming pools, individuals with aquaphobia can gain insights into their fears and anxieties. These dreams can serve as a catalyst for personal growth and healing, empowering individuals to confront their fears and work towards overcoming them.

4. People Who Are Going Through a Major Life Change
For individuals navigating significant life transitions, dreams featuring above-ground swimming pools can hold profound symbolic meanings. These pools, often perceived as temporary and movable, mirror the fluidity and adaptability required during times of change.
The act of entering or exiting the pool symbolizes embarking on or concluding a transformative journey. The water itself represents emotions, and immersing oneself in it suggests delving into and processing deep feelings associated with the life change.
If the pool is clean and inviting, it may indicate a positive outlook and a sense of readiness for the transition. Conversely, a dirty or murky pool could reflect apprehension, uncertainty, or emotional turmoil.
The presence of others in the pool speaks to the dreamer's support system. Friends and family swimming alongside can symbolize a strong network of individuals providing encouragement and guidance during the transition.
Alternatively, being alone in the pool might highlight the need for self-reflection and introspection as the dreamer navigates the change independently.
Ultimately, the symbolism of an above-ground swimming pool in dreams is deeply personal and can vary depending on the individual's unique circumstances and experiences. By reflecting on the details and emotions associated with the dream, individuals can gain insights into their inner thoughts and feelings regarding the major life change they are undergoing.
